MAC Sheer Minerals/Sheersheen Powder


Hitting MAC counters on the 16th is the Sheer Minerals Collection. There are 3 components- Mineralize SPF foundation loose, Sheersheen Loose Powder and Mineralize Skinfinish.

Sheersheen is loose , very shimmery powder thats very finely blended and will work great on face or body. It has almost a spreadable way to it. The one I have here is Lucent which is a pretty pale pink pearl. The jar is good size and has a shaker top. It has a bit of pigment as well. It's not really what I call overly sheer. You get color and could easily blend it into your blush with a more matte shade.

Other colors are Sheer Bronze and Silver Aura . I have seen the bronze one also and it's a medium /deep bronze shade. Sheersheen will sell for $19.50

Mineralize Loose foundation is the super wonderful Mineralize Skinfinish Natural powder foundation in a loose form. Can't wait to try this as I love the pressed one. ( If you haven't tried these, you must.) Makeup Artists at MAC call it the "16 yr. old skin" foundation. It took me ages to try and I wonder why I waited so darn long.

Lastly, Mineralize Skinfinish is a marbled skin powder , and comes in 3 shades also:

Soft and Gentle- Peach/bronze
So Ceylon-Rose Bronze
Petticoat-Pale Rose
